z = - 3 + i
Solution:  
We have , z = - 3 + i
Let - 3 = r cos θ ... (i) and 1 = r sin θ ... (ii)
Squaring and adding (i) and (ii), we get
r2(cos2θ+sin2θ) = 3 + 1 ⇒ r2 = 4 ⇒ r = 2
Substituting the value of r in (i) and (ii), we get 2 cos θ = - 3 , 2 sin θ = 1

Here, cosθ is negative where sinθ is positive.
∴ θ lies in the second quadrant.
